The BINC-B trial is a diagnostic and interventional study in which various function imaging methods as Magnetic Resonance Imaging (PWI, DWI and DCE-MRI) and will be compared with common imaging methods (mammography and/or ultrasound) to investigate if an early response to a combined neoadjuvant chemotherapy in operable or potentially operable breast cancer. For breast cancer patients with positive HER-2, additional Herceptin could improve the response further. In this study the efficacy of combined neoadjuvant therapy with or without Herceptin should be evaluated and the role in predicting the tumor response with different imaging should be estimated.
详细描述
Firstly, the investigators aim to show that the results of functional imaging including dynamic enhanced, diffuse weighted, and perfusion MR imaging biomarkers as well the ultrasonic outcome could be used to predict the response to the neoadjuvant chemotherapy for operable and potentially operable breast cancer (luminal B, HER-2 positive and triple negative).
Secondly, the investigators will study the role of peripheral blood biomarker including circulating tumor DNA (ctDNA), circulating endothelial cells (CECs) and subsets, myeloid-derived suppressor cells (MDSCs), and lymph cell subsets and their combinations could predict the response of the tumor measured with imaging.
Thirdly, the investigators will establish a mode with these multiple imaging and serum biomarker panel as well as their changes during the treatment course establish to predict the response to neoadjuvant chemotherapy.

Neoadjuvant chemotherapy
Epirubicin 100mg/m2 and cyclophosphamine 600mg/m2 for four cycles followed by paclitaxol 175mg/m2 for four cycles with (for patients with positive HER-2) or without Trastuzumab (loading dose of 6 mg/kg followed by 4 mg/kg every 2 weeks for four cycles), each cycle is 14 days.

pathological complete response (pCR)
时间窗: from the first day of the the first cycle (each cycle is 14 days) of neoadjuvant chemotherapy to the date that breast and axillary sugery will be performed
Rate of pathological complete response (pCR) following neoadjuvant therapy and to determine efficacy of neoadjuvant therapy in primary breast cancer using pCR (According to National Surgical Adjuvant Breast and Bowel Project guideline)
次要结局
- Response rate(from the first day of the the first cycle (each cycle is 14 days) of neoadjuvant chemotherapy to the date that breast and axillary sugery will be performed)
- Disease free survival(from the first day of the the first cycle of neoadjuvant chemotherapy (each cycle is 14 days) to the date of first documented progression or date of death from breast cancer, whichever came first, assessed up to 60 months)
- Overall survival(from the first day of the the first cycle (each cycle is 14 days) of neoadjuvant chemotherapy to the date of death from any cause, whichever came first, assessed up to 60 months)
